Karim I live in Alex and have been searching for a reputable salon for over a year now. I just tried Sheraton Montazah Salon last Friday. I had a cut and a highlight and it was 500LEs. The service was ok, but was certainly not great. I have been happy with the same cut and highlight at Carven (just a bit up the street from the Sheraton) for 400LEs less. Sheraton Salon lacked in cleanliness like all the rest I have tried. I don't think that what I had done was worth 500LEs when the salon wasn't clean and the stylists didn't speak English. I wouldn't go back a second time. I've heard that the salons at the Hilton Green Plaza are good...I will let you know
